如何实现html静态页修改本地html、js文件

我有一个html静态页,我可以配合js修改网页里的各种数据,但我刷新就没有了,能否实现不通过服务器,本地修改保存我电脑本地上html、js文件?(不是通过下载方式建立一个新文件,如果是安全限制问题有什么方法解决,我只要本机上达到效果即可)

可以使用localStorage,这是HTML5的一个特性。相当于是前端页面的一个数据库。可以存储5M以内的数据。在不手动清除的情况下,将永久存储。

写入和读出的时候需要注意一下,写入需要将JSON对象转换成JSON字符串,读的时候需要将JSON字符串转换成JSON对象。比如我们要存储:水果的名称和价钱

var fruit = {
name: 'apple',
price: '20'
}
var f = JSON.stringify(fruit) //转化成JSON字符串
window.localStorage.setItem('fruit', f) //存储到本地
=====================================================
var aa = window.localStorage.getItem('fruit') //读存储的数据
var aaObj = JSON.parse(aa) //将JSON字符串转化成JSON对象方便读取

温馨提示:内容为网友见解,仅供参考
第1个回答  2019-05-26
可以使用localStorage
相似回答